What are the key skills and qualifications needed to thrive as a Flex Biotech Data Scientist, and why are they important?

To thrive as a Flex Biotech Data Scientist, you need a strong background in biology, statistics, and data analysis, typically supported by a degree in bioinformatics, computational biology, or a related field. Expertise in programming languages (such as Python or R), experience with bioinformatics tools, and familiarity with platforms like SQL databases and machine learning frameworks are essential. Strong problem-solving skills, collaboration, and the ability to communicate complex findings to non-technical stakeholders make candidates stand out. These skills are crucial for extracting actionable insights from complex biological data, driving innovation, and supporting research and development in biotech environments.

How do Flex Biotech Data Science professionals typically collaborate with laboratory and research teams?

Flex Biotech Data Science professionals often work closely with laboratory scientists and research teams to interpret experimental data, refine data collection methods, and translate complex results into actionable insights. This collaboration involves regular meetings to discuss ongoing projects, sharing data findings, and providing statistical expertise to optimize research outcomes. Effective communication and a solid understanding of both computational and biological concepts are essential for bridging the gap between data science and laboratory work.

Can a biotechnologist become a data scientist?

A biotechnologist can become a data scientist by acquiring skills in programming, statistics, and machine learning, often through online courses or advanced degrees. Their background in biology can be valuable for data analysis in biotech and healthcare industries, but they need to develop expertise in data manipulation tools like Python, R, and SQL. Transitioning may also involve gaining experience with data visualization and working with large datasets.

Job Summary:
Thermo Fisher Scientific is a global leader in scientific solutions, and they are seeking a Senior Product Manager to lead the lifecycle of Cell Culture services. This role focuses on scientific workflows, digital innovation, and commercial strategy, driving the adoption of AI/ML-enabled capabilities across various markets.
Responsibilities:
• Own the full product lifecycle from market analysis and VOC through product definition, launch, and continuous optimization for Cell Culture Workflow Services and early AI/analytics capabilities.
• Define product vision, strategy, and multi-quarter roadmap; establish clear success metrics aligned to business objectives.
• Lead customer-facing VOC initiatives, develop relationships with key opinion leaders and pilot partners, and translate insights into actionable product requirements.
• Conduct market and competitive analysis; build financial models and forecasts to inform investment and commercial decisions.
• Lead pilots, proofs-of-concept, and early deployments of AI/ML-driven solutions; define KPIs, evaluate outcomes, and scale successful offerings.
• Partner cross-functionally with R&D, data science, regulatory, commercial, marketing, and services teams to deliver compliant, scalable solutions.
• Drive go-to-market execution, including product positioning, sales enablement, marketing collateral, and launch planning.
• Track and report on product KPIs (adoption, pilot conversion, revenue impact, customer satisfaction, forecast accuracy) and proactively manage risks.
• Coordinate releases and pilot activities across global sites, including Grand Island, Hunt Valley, and regional BDCs.
Qualifications:
Required:
• Advanced degree with five years of experience, or Bachelor’s degree with eight years of experience in product management, marketing, or related commercial roles in the life sciences industry.
• Demonstrated success managing complex product portfolios and scaling pilots into commercial offerings.
• Proven experience with product lifecycle management and stage-gate processes.
• Strong analytical and financial modeling skills for forecasting and business planning.
• Excellent written and verbal communication skills, including development of sales and marketing materials.
• Deep understanding of customer workflows and ability to translate insights into product requirements.
• Experience planning and executing product launches and marketing campaigns.
• Customer-centric mindset with a consultative approach to solution development.
• Willingness to travel up to 30% (2-3 times a year when needed) for customer engagement and site visits.
Preferred:
• Preferred industry experience in Life Sciences, Biotech, or Biopharma.
• Preferred field of study: Life Science, Chemistry or Business.
• Ability to speak Mandarin to support engagement with China-based customers and partners.
• Experience working with APJ markets, particularly China, within a commercial or product management capacity.
